SPLAT PATTER PLOP! Zookeeper Bob's super-duper pooper scooper robot has disappeared and the POO is piling UP! Is this a DOO-DOO disaster?

Or can Arabella Slater - Poo Investigator - save the day?
Children will love this riotously funny sequel to Amazon bestseller Poo in the Zoo. Perfect for existing fans or newcomers who loved The Dinosaur That Pooped a Planet, this rollicking, rhyming text packed with EVEN MORE POO will have everyone howling with laughter.

About Steve Smallman

Steve Smallman Biography
Steve Smallman has been illustrating children's books for over 30 years and began writing children's stories 10 years ago, now having written over 50 books. He also teaches illustration and mural-painting workshops in schools.
